ID verification software plays a pivotal role in modern security frameworks by authenticating individuals’ identities through various digital means. These systems typically analyze government-issued identification documents and employ biometric verification techniques to confirm authenticity. The software is designed to reduce manual verification errors, accelerate approval times, and enhance overall security. It is widely utilized across industries such as banking, insurance, telecommunications, and online marketplaces, where identity assurance is paramount.

The core functionality of ID verification software involves scanning and analyzing identity documents. This process includes Optical Character Recognition (OCR) to extract data, verification against official databases, and fraud detection mechanisms to identify counterfeit documents. Biometric verification, such as facial recognition and liveness detection, adds an additional security layer by matching the individual’s live image with the document photo. This multi-factor authentication approach significantly reduces the risk of identity fraud.

Integration capabilities are another critical aspect when evaluating ID verification software. The best solutions offer flexible application programming interfaces (APIs) and software development kits (SDKs) that allow seamless incorporation into existing workflows and platforms. This adaptability ensures that businesses can maintain operational continuity while enhancing their identity verification processes.

Compliance with regulations such as the USA PATRIOT Act, Anti-Money Laundering (AML) laws, and Know Your Customer (KYC) requirements is essential for many organizations. Leading ID verification software providers ensure their products meet these standards, offering audit trails and data protection features to safeguard sensitive information.

Comparison of Leading ID Verification Software Solutions

Software Key Features Supported Documents Biometric Verification Integration Pricing (USD)
Jumio AI-powered ID & identity verification, liveness detection, fraud detection Passports, Driver’s Licenses, ID Cards worldwide Facial recognition, Liveness detection API, SDK, Web Portal From $1 per verification
Onfido Document verification, biometric facial comparison, global coverage Passports, Driver’s Licenses, National IDs Facial biometrics, Liveness check API, SDK Custom pricing based on volume
ID.me Multi-factor authentication, document verification, identity proofing US Driver’s Licenses, Passports, State IDs Facial recognition, Video selfie API, Web Portal Free for consumers, enterprise pricing available
Veriff Automated ID verification, fraud detection, multi-language support Passports, Driver’s Licenses, ID Cards from 190+ countries Face match, Liveness detection API, SDK Starts at $1.50 per verification
Trulioo Global identity verification, document & data verification, AML compliance Passports, Driver’s Licenses, National IDs Facial recognition API Custom pricing

Applications Across Industries

ID verification software is widely used in financial services for customer onboarding, fraud prevention, and regulatory compliance. E-commerce platforms utilize these tools to verify buyers and sellers, reducing fraudulent transactions. Healthcare providers employ identity verification to secure patient data and ensure proper access to services. Government agencies use such software for issuing licenses, benefits, and other identity-dependent services. The versatility and reliability of these solutions make them indispensable in today’s digital economy.

Future Trends in ID Verification Technology

Advancements in artificial intelligence and machine learning continue to improve the accuracy and efficiency of ID verification software. Emerging technologies such as blockchain are being explored to create decentralized and tamper-proof identity verification systems. Additionally, increased focus on privacy-preserving techniques ensures that identity verification processes comply with stringent data protection laws while maintaining user convenience. As cyber threats evolve, the best ID verification software will integrate adaptive security measures to stay ahead of fraudsters.
